Tariff Notice No. 1984/10—Applications for Approval Declined
NOTICE is hereby given that applications for concessionary rates of duty by the approval of the Minister of Customs on goods as follows have been declined:
| Port | Appn. No. | Tariff Item | Goods | Applications Advertised |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Tariff Notice No. | Gazette No. | ||||
| CH | 349 | 35.06.000 | Planatowrk opimelt 827 and 827/A, hot melt adhesive, for use in bookbinding machines | 1983/207 | 187, 10 November 1983, p. 3950 |
| CH | 345 | 84.11.051 | Bambi model 75 pump units only | 1983/207 | 187, 10 November 1983, p. 3950 |
| CH | 358 | 84.63.029 | Transmital gear boxes | 1983/207 | 187, 10 November 1983, p. 3950 |
Dated at Wellington this 19th day of January 1984.
P. J. McKONE, Comptroller of Customs.
Tariff Notice No. 1984/11—Applications for Continuation of Approval
NOTICE is hereby given that applications have been made to the Minister of Customs for the continuation of the following concessions at the rates of Customs Duty shown:
| Port | Appn. No. | Tariff Item | Goods | Rates of Duty | Part II Ref. |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Normal | Pref. | |||||
| DN | C3880 | 15.10.001 | Distilled linseed oil | Free* | Free* | 25 |
| DN | C3887 | 30.03.039 | Coal tar solution, B.P., in bulk drums | Free* | Free* | 15 |
| DN | C3882 | 35.05.003 | Daxad 19, a dispersing agent | Free* | Free* | 15 |
| DN | C3874 | 38.19.079 | Placal Z3624, used in making paper bags | Free* | Free | 15 |
| DN | C3873 | 38.19.079 | Syloid 161 | Free* | Free | 15 |
| DN | C3875 | 38.19.079 | Syloid 308 | Free* | Free | 15 |
| DN | C3872 | 38.19.079 | Syloid 385 | Free* | Free* | 15 |
| DN | C3879 | 84.17.009 | Aluminium sections, when declared by a manufacturer for use by him, only in making filters | Free* | Free* | 10 |
| DN | C3892 | 91.06.000 | Heaters, industrial, water, operated by mixing steam with cold water AMF Venner/Paragon time switches, when declared by an importer that they are for industrial use only | Free* | Free | 99 |
*or such higher rate of duty as the Minister may in any case decide
The identification reference to the application number indicates the office to which any objections should be made.
DN—Collector of Customs, Dunedin.
Any person wishing to lodge an objection to the granting of these applications should do so in writing to the appropriate office as indicated by the identification reference on or before 9 February 1984. Submissions should include a reference to the identification reference, application number, Tariff Item, and description of goods concerned and be supported by information as to:
(a) The range of equivalent goods manufactured locally;
(b) The proportion of New Zealand and imported material used in manufacture;
(c) Present and potential output; and
(d) Details of factory cost in terms of materials, labour, overhead, etc.
Dated at Wellington this 19th day of January 1984.
P. J. McKONE, Comptroller of Customs.
New Zealand Railways Corporation—Schedule of Civil Engineering and Building Contracts of $20,000 or More in Value
| Name of Contract | Name and Address of Contractor | Amount of Contract $ | Date Advised |
|---|---|---|---|
| Auckland Station Building—Reroofing of Subway Ramp | Gunac South Auckland Ltd., P.O. Box 23-254, Papatoetoe | 26,189.85 | 14 December 1983 |
| Gore—Paint Station Building | R. T. Martin, 23 Ingram Street, Invercargill | 42,700.00 | 20 December 1983 |
| Bridge 137 PNGL—Upgrading Existing Bridge | Morris & Bailey Ltd., P.O. Box 60, Woodville | 267,000.00 | 5 December 1983 |
(10/2100/9)
H. G. PURDY, General Manager.
